Navy Awards Harris $9 M for Aircraft Cockpit DMC

1,000 Units Delivered-To-Date Provide Military Pilots Worldwide with Enhanced Situational Awareness

(Melbourne, FL, July 22, 2008) -- Harris Corporation (NYSE:HRS), an international communications and information technology company, has been awarded a two-year, $9.1 million follow-on production contract by the U.S. Navy to supply digital map computers that provide military aircrews with advanced situational awareness via cockpit displays. The contract brings the total value of the Tactical Airborne Moving Map Capability (TAMMAC) program to Harris to more than $100 million since 1997. The total contract is expected to reach $120 million by 2012.

Under the latest installment, Harris will supply more than 200 digital map computers for use on a variety of military jets and helicopters. The company hosted Navy VIPs today for a ceremony marking the delivery of the 1,000th unit as part the previous contract.

The TAMMAC Digital Map Computer (DMC) provides aircrews with a graphical presentation of the aircraft's current position, as well as the relative positions of targets, threats, terrain features, planned mission flight path, and other information. The DMC's advanced mapping capabilities significantly increase mission effectiveness and ensure that flight crews are operating with the most sophisticated terrain and threat data available. A new version of the DMC, the Digital Video Map Computer (DVMC), provides a 1024x1280 high-resolution digital moving map image channel.

The TAMMAC map is used on the U.S. Navy's FA-18C/D, FA-18E/F and EA-18G; the U.S. Marine Corps' F/A-18A/C/D, AV-8B, AH-1Z, and UH-1Y; the EH-101 for Denmark and Italy; the CF-18 A/B for Canada; and the FA-18A/B for Australia.

"This most recent award and delivery of the 1,000th DMC unit are key milestones in this program, which provides pilots with two independent channels of real-time, digital moving map data, and threat and terrain conflict overlays in various display modes," said Wes Covell, president of Harris Defense Programs. "We are very proud of this program's success and of our ability to continue to provide this advanced technology for enhanced levels of situational awareness that support such a wide variety of aircraft."
